Summary Barney Panofsky is a seemingly ordinary man who lives an extraordinary life. With his father, Izzy as his sidekick, Barney reflects on the many highs, and a few too many lows, of his long and colorful life. Not only does Barney turn out to be a true romantic, he is also capable of all kinds of sneaky acts of gallantry, generosity, and goodness when it is least expected. His gloriously full life is played out on a grand scale all the way through the final chapters.
